[QUOTE="SPECIAL LOCATION, post: 549743, member: 250"] Impossible to conclude anything from the information given.. And you have made no mention of the reason(s) why you think the 16mm SWA is faulty? I think you need to prove continuity of all conductors.. R1, R2, Rn and the armour. Then confirm insulation resistance between all conductors, and armour, before you could even hazard a guess if there are any issues with the SWA.? I think you also need a calibrated test meter that can zero the leads, before attempting any continuity measurements. Random guess work testing, without any idea of what results you should expect is just a waste of time in my opinion. [/QUOTE]
